Megan Thee Stallion and Beyoncé Make Historical past at 2021 Grammys

Image source: Getty / Rich Fury

Megan Thee Stallion just won her first Grammy and made history in the process! Before the official show, the 26-year-old rapper took home the award for best rap performance for her hit “Savage” with Beyoncé during the premiere on Sunday. Not only does this make her an official Grammy winner, but it is also the first time in history that an all-female collaboration has won the category.

Of course, Megan couldn’t hold back her excitement about the most important milestone. “Thank you Lord. God is the first person I want to thank,” Megan said in her speech. “I just still can’t even believe it … thank everyone who just rocks with me and has been riding with me for a long time. I love you all so much. Thank you for believing in me.” Shortly thereafter, Megan tweeted, “AHHHHHHHJHGJDKNBOOM” with a bunch of crying emoji faces. She also thanked her fans, adding, “I love you, beauties.”
